About this training

Summary

This European Standard defines the qualification test of welders for the fusion welding of steels.
It provides a set of technical rules for a systematic qualification test of the welder, and enables such qualifications to be uniformly accepted independently of the type of product, location and examiner/ examining body.
When qualifying welders, the emphasis is placed on the welders ability to manually manipulate the electrode/ welding torch/ welding blowpipe and thereby producing a weld of acceptable quality.
The welding processes referred to in this European Standard include those fusion welding processes which are designated as manual or partly mechanized welding. It does not cover fully mechanized and automated welding processes (see EN 1418).
